Who We Are:
The Ideal Tridon Group comprises a family of brands that support, secure, and connect the movement of air, fluid, and electricity in critical applications. With over 100 years of proven quality and a strong culture of service, we are the worldwide leader in clamps, strut, hose supports, conduit, fittings, and coupling solutions. Our products are engineered to meet the highest standards across a range of industries, and our commitment to innovation, reliability, and customer support ensures we’re ready to meet the demands of today and tomorrow. At the Ideal Tridon Group, connections aren’t just what we make—they’re the heart of everything we do.

Position Summary:
Work in a non-climate-controlled manufacturing setting that may include dust and debris and can be loud at times. Perform various tasks involved in general labor operation including but not limited to setting up and operating machines, handling parts and materials, packing parts and other related activities using hand tools, various type of packing materials. must follow all applicable safety procedures to avoid injuries including requests for help from co-workers. Proper handling of finished parts and products to avoid injuries or damage, follow all operational instructions when operating or using tools and equipment. Provide quality checks as determined.
Job Responsibilities:
- Performs general manual labor tasks including loading, unloading, lifting, and moving materials.
- Responsibly for quality inspection
- Will operate power forklift
- Responsibility for correctly warehousing/ storing finished goods
- Assists with any other manual labor tasks as needed.
